Details
A vulnerability was found in openSUSE Open Build Service (the affected version is unknown). It has been classified as critical. Affected is an unknown code of the component obs-service-tar_scm.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a path traversal v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-22. The product uses external input to construct a pathname that is intended to identify a file or directory that is located underneath a restricted parent directory, but the product does not properly neutralize special elements within the pathname that can cause the pathname to resolve to a location that is outside of the restricted directory.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
A path traversal traversal vulnerability in obs-service-tar_scm of Open Build Service allows remote attackers to cause access files not in the current build. On the server itself this is prevented by confining the worker via KVM. Affected releases are openSUSE Open Build Service: versions prior to 70d1aa4cc4d7b940180553a63805c22fc62e2cf0.
The bug was discovered 09/26/2018. The weakness was shared 10/02/2018 as Bug 1105361 as confirmed bug report (Bugzilla). The advisory is available at bugzilla.suse.com.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-2018-12473 since 06/15/2018.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ploitation doesn't require any form of authentication.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not available. This vulnerability is assigned to T1006 by the MITRE ATT&CK project.
The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 6 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 172208 (OpenSUSE Security Update for obs-service-tar_scm (openSUSE-SU-2019:0326-1)).
Applying the patch 70d1aa4cc4d7b940180553a63805c22fc62e2cf0 is able to eliminate this problem.
